This plot

Trending plot for photometric zeropoints.

Photometric standard star fields are typically only measured when they are needed to calibrate science observations in clear or photometric nights. There may be more than one measurement per filter and per night if the science observations require photometric conditions. The zeropoints plotted on the Health Check pages are averages for each night of the zeropoints from the individual measurements.

The plotted values have been converted from ADU to electrons. Please note that downloaded zeropoints from the database are in ADU. The difference to the plotted values is 2.5 * log10(CONAD).

WARNING: Zeropoints have been computed using constant extinction coefficients and zero color terms, with the main purpose of instrument and site performance monitoring. Though they are reasonably precise, they are not suitable for accurate photometric calibrations.

The FULL plot has M1 coating marked with blue vertical lines, M1 washing with cyan lines (since 2010 only).

Template ID: img_cal_Photom. Pipeline recipes: vmimstandard (individual pointing) / vmimcalphot (averaging).
